From 32e505f8b1b93d58b91d633da70597fb7affd344 Mon Sep 17 00:00:00 2001 From: gengby <858962040@qq.com> Date: Wed, 20 Dec 2023 08:49:13 +0800 Subject: [PATCH] =?UTF-8?q?rev:=E8=87=AA=E5=8A=A8=E5=AE=8C=E6=88=90?= =?UTF-8?q?=E6=97=B6=E6=9B=B4=E6=94=B9=E7=89=A9=E6=96=99=E6=9D=A5=E6=BA=90?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../instruction/service/impl/InstructionServiceImpl.java | 1 + .../org/nl/modules/quartz/task/QueryXZAgvTaskStatus.java | 8 ++++---- 2 files changed, 5 insertions(+), 4 deletions(-) diff --git a/hd/nladmin-system/src/main/java/org/nl/acs/instruction/service/impl/InstructionServiceImpl.java b/hd/nladmin-system/src/main/java/org/nl/acs/instruction/service/impl/InstructionServiceImpl.java index ac092c6..c44c55a 100644 --- a/hd/nladmin-system/src/main/java/org/nl/acs/instruction/service/impl/InstructionServiceImpl.java +++ b/hd/nladmin-system/src/main/java/org/nl/acs/instruction/service/impl/InstructionServiceImpl.java @@ -783,6 +783,7 @@ public class InstructionServiceImpl implements InstructionService, ApplicationAu jo1.put("material_type", dto.getMaterial()); jo1.put("batch", dto.getBatch()); jo1.put("vehicle_code", dto.getVehicle_code()); + jo1.put("source_device", dto.getStart_device_code()); deviceService.changeDeviceStatus(jo1); LampThreecolorDeviceDriver lampThreecolorDeviceDriver; diff --git a/hd/nladmin-system/src/main/java/org/nl/modules/quartz/task/QueryXZAgvTaskStatus.java b/hd/nladmin-system/src/main/java/org/nl/modules/quartz/task/QueryXZAgvTaskStatus.java index b08788c..49b5a8f 100644 --- a/hd/nladmin-system/src/main/java/org/nl/modules/quartz/task/QueryXZAgvTaskStatus.java +++ b/hd/nladmin-system/src/main/java/org/nl/modules/quartz/task/QueryXZAgvTaskStatus.java @@ -109,11 +109,11 @@ public class QueryXZAgvTaskStatus { } } else if ("STOPPED".equals(state) || "FAILED".equals(state) || "Error".equals(state)) { if (inst != null) { -// inst.setInstruction_status("1"); -// instructionService.update(inst); + inst.setInstruction_status("1"); + instructionService.update(inst); //任务失败时取消指令和任务 - instructionService.cancel(inst.getInstruction_id()); - taskService.cancel(inst.getTask_id()); +// instructionService.cancel(inst.getInstruction_id()); +// taskService.cancel(inst.getTask_id()); } } // else if ("STOPPED".equals(state)){